The England centre-back suffered the problem in training ahead of their Champions League opener against Shakhtar Donetsk on Tuesday.
"He (Stones) is out for four, five or six weeks. He was injured in training this morning. It is a muscular problem," Guardiola said.
Stones' absence will add lớn the defensive problems for Guardiola, with French centre-back Aymeric Laporte already likely lớn be ruled out until the New Year.

In Laporte's absence, City conceded three goals in a shock defeat at Norwich on Saturday as Stones and Nicolas Otamendi struggled.
Guardiola defended his players, saying: "I have a lot of respect for what John and Nico have done.
"Football is not about how you handle good situations. It is about how you handle the bad ones."
Midfielder Phil Foden has also not travelled with the squad to Ukraine due to illness as City prepare lớn face an opponent they and Guardiola have come up against on several occasions in recent seasons.
"I bought an apartment here! I have come here many times. Always it is good. With Barcelona, Bayern Munich and now City I have been here almost every season," Guardiola added.
